Dressing: 1/2 cup olive oil; 3 tablespoons ...The muffuletta bread is as special and important as the olive salad. It’s a lot like focaccia, only… different. And topped with sesame seeds. It’s crispy on the outside and light on the inside, yet holds up beautifully to the oil in the olive salad. In fact, it acts like a magical sponge that absorbs the oil without getting soggy.Step 1 Make salad: In a large bowl, toss together chickpeas, cucumber, bell pepper, red onion, olives, and feta.
